Transaction

ecdc46a9aad72de747b57e6ca782faa7d9f342078dc92aae4e9d4246b2f92e34
499,778 confirmations
Timestamp
1478670304
Block438,018
Fee65,609 sats
Fee rate55.9 sats/vB
view on mempool.space

Inputs & Outputs